Idling a little weird

Ok, when she is all warmed up at a good temp she seemed to have a fluxuating idle. Basicly at idle she jumps up and down, not too high or low, just not steady.
Any ideas?
 
my first guess would be an air leak, that's what the symptoms sound like
 
yes sounds like a ir leak causeing a lean condition

Rob
 
I thought it might be a air leak. I put a dynamite fuel filter and noticed that if you tighten the two halfs it spits the o-ring out.

It is a 2.5 Eddy.

I had the engine off to clean Matts, the backplate looked fine with no oil residue around seals..

Thanks guys, I am willing to bet it is the fuel filter.
 
There one other thing that can cause it to act up a dirty airfilter. If you not getting good air flow your idle will go up and down as the engine tries to get air.
 
My 2.5 came out of the box with a pinhole in the fuel line right next to the carb. You may want to replace the cheep factory stuff with some good clear line. May not be your issue but thought I would mention it.
 
Thanks guys, I think I will be replacing the fuel and pressure lines.

Replaced the gasket in the filter with a tighter fitting one.
Then I did a pressure lockdown test, all was fine.
Took her out and she purrs like a kitten.:cheers:
